Metalworks Studios

Metalworks Studios is a music recording studio in Mississauga, Ontario (Greater Toronto Area), Canada. It was established in 1978 by Gil Moore of the Canadian rock group Triumph (Inductee of the Mississauga Music Walk of Fame). Over a span of more than 30 years, Metalworks has become one of Canada's best recording studios and has expanded into a six studio facility offering in-house tracking, mixing and mastering, as well as video editing and DVD authoring. In 2004, Metalworks Studios launched an adjacent educational facility; Metalworks Institute.
